高并发高可用架构演进 : 数据库、应用于一体?数据库与应用分离?数据库根据业务将表分到不同的库中?同一张表进行读写分离?表中数据根据需求分表 其中Mycat数据库中间件起到了读写分离,分库,分表的作用 1.解决的问题 读写分离 (Mysql主从复制)/分库分表 ? 多数据源 ? Java程序需要进行 ...
分类:
其他好文 时间:
2020-04-26 12:32:00
阅读次数:
76
1、Master-Slave主从结构主从架构一般用于备份或者做读写分离。一般有一主一从设计和一主多从设计。由两种角色构成:(1)主(Master)可读可写,当数据有修改的时候,会将oplog同步到所有连接的salve上去。(2)从(Slave)只读不可写,自动从Master同步数据。特别的,对于Mongodb来说,并不推荐使用Master-Slave架构,因为Master-Slave其中Maste
分类:
数据库 时间:
2020-04-24 17:23:26
阅读次数:
81
? ? 最近免费试用了一下云服务器,然后在两台服务器上安装了Mysql并搭建了主从同步数据库。mysql数据库的安装,大家可以去查看我的另一篇博客文章,下面为大家介绍搭建步骤及原理。 ? ? mysql主节点即master节点在每次对数据库执行操作后会将操作写入到本地的二进制日志(binary lo ...
分类:
数据库 时间:
2020-04-22 09:44:27
阅读次数:
506
MySQL主从同步配置 1.编辑MySQL主上的/etc/my.cnf log-bin=imooc_mysql server-id=1 log-bin :MySQL的bin-log的名字 server-id : MySQL实例中全局唯一,并且大于0。 2.编辑MySQL从上的/etc/my.cnf ...
分类:
数据库 时间:
2020-04-21 13:16:46
阅读次数:
71
实验,演示过了 redis cluster模式下,不建议做物理的读写分离了 我们建议通过master的水平扩容,来横向扩展读写吞吐量,还有支撑更多的海量数据 redis单机,读吞吐是5w/s,写吞吐2w/s 扩展redis更多master,那么如果有5台master,不就读吞吐可以达到总量25/s ...
分类:
其他好文 时间:
2020-04-21 09:16:58
阅读次数:
56
redis cluster最最基础的一些知识 redis cluster: 自动,master+slave复制和读写分离,master+slave高可用和主备切换,支持多个master的hash slot支持数据分布式存储 停止之前所有的实例,包括redis主从和哨兵集群 1、redis clust ...
分类:
其他好文 时间:
2020-04-20 23:33:26
阅读次数:
80
你如果要对自己刚刚搭建好的redis做一个基准的压测,测一下你的redis的性能和QPS(query per second) redis自己提供的redis-benchmark压测工具,是最快捷最方便的,当然啦,这个工具比较简单,用一些简单的操作和场景去压测 1、对redis读写分离架构进行压测,单 ...
分类:
其他好文 时间:
2020-04-17 23:36:02
阅读次数:
83
1、启用复制,部署slave node wget http://downloads.sourceforge.net/tcl/tcl8.6.1-src.tar.gztar -xzvf tcl8.6.1-src.tar.gzcd /usr/local/tcl8.6.1/unix/./configure ...
分类:
其他好文 时间:
2020-04-17 23:34:08
阅读次数:
74
1、redis高并发跟整个系统的高并发之间的关系 redis,你要搞高并发的话,不可避免,要把底层的缓存搞得很好 mysql,高并发,做到了,那么也是通过一系列复杂的分库分表,订单系统,事务要求的,QPS到几万,比较高了 要做一些电商的商品详情页,真正的超高并发,QPS上十万,甚至是百万,一秒钟百万 ...
分类:
其他好文 时间:
2020-04-17 00:10:21
阅读次数:
57